"Bury My Heart At Wounded Knee: An Indian History of the American West" by Dee Brown. Describes the American expansion westward across North America and the resulting Indian Wars of the second half of the 1800s, from the point of view of the Native Americans who were repeatedly and forcibly removed from ancestral lands and resettled. In center of book, there is an unnumbered section "An American Indian Portrait Gallery". Includes bibliography and index.
